Graph the equation by plotting points:y=-2x+4

Here are a few points to graph:

To find the coordinates of a point you will have to substitute the x for y value then find the y. For example:

if we substitute x for-2 the equation will become: y=(-2*-2)+4=4+4=8. and so on so here are a few x points:

X=-2: Y=4+4=8

X=-1: Y=2+4=6

X=0: Y=0+4=4 (X-INTERCEPT)

X=1: Y=-2+4=2

X=2: Y=-4+4=0 (Y-INTERCEPT)

X=3: Y=-6+4=-2

X=4: Y=-8+4=-4

X=5: Y=-10+4=-6
